    Minister Daryll Matthew Cheers on St. John’s Rural South Carnival Contenders

    Creative Industries Minister Daryll Matthew has extended best wishes to a host of performers and competitors from St. John’s Rural South as they gear up for the 2025 Carnival competitions.

    In a statement of encouragement, Minister Matthew praised the “incredible talents” representing the community across various events, including the Junior Calypso Monarch, Panorama, and Queen of Carnival competitions.

    Those representing St. John’s Rural South include:

    • De Archer, Naima, and Kaisocal in the Junior Calypso Monarch
    • Lyrikal Boss in the Junior Party Monarch
    • Kimora Simon and Otezzéa Luke in the Mr. & Miss Teenage Pageant
    • Queen Singing Althea and Kid Fresh in the Calypso and Party Monarch competitions
    • Pandemonium Steel Orchestra in the Panorama competition
    • Miss Danijha Simon in the Queen of Carnival

    “Let’s continue to celebrate and uplift the talent that shines in our community,” Matthew said, adding, “It’s a vibe every time St. John’s Rural South steps on stage!”

    The minister’s remarks highlight the strong cultural showing from his constituency and the pride the community takes in Carnival season.
